排序
如何在Python中创建FastAPI应用?
如何创建一个fastapi应用?在python中创建fastapi应用只需几行代码即可。1. 导入fastapi并创建实例:from fastapi import fastapi; app = fastapi()。2. 使用装饰器定义路由,如@app.get('/')。...
如何在CentOS上进行数据备份
centos服务器数据备份指南:确保数据安全 数据备份是维护CentOS服务器数据安全性的关键步骤。本文将介绍几种常用的备份方法、最佳实践以及一个示例备份脚本。 常用备份方法 rsync命令: rsync是...
如何在Oracle数据库中设置表的只读权限?
在Oracle数据库中,设置表的只读权限是非常重要的操作,可以保护数据的安全性并防止误操作。下面将介绍如何在Oracle数据库中设置表的只读权限,并提供具体的代码示例。 首先,我们需要了解在Ora...
软删除(Soft Delete)的实现与恢复逻辑
使用软删除的原因是它允许数据恢复和保持数据完整性。1) 软删除通过标记数据为已删除而非实际删除,提供了数据恢复的可能性。2) 它保持数据的历史记录,确保数据完整性。实现软删除通常在数据库...
C++怎么使用智能指针 C++智能指针的类型与使用场景
c++++智能指针通过raii机制自动管理内存,避免内存泄漏。1. unique_ptr实现独占式所有权,确保同一时间只有一个指针指向对象,支持显式转移所有权,适用于资源管理和工厂函数返回值;2. shared_...
linux中mysql的1045错误怎么解决
解决方法:1、登录数据库之后,利用“select host,user from user;”语句查询用户和权限;2、利用“grant select,update,insert,delete on mas.* to 新建用户@localhost identified by '密码';...
想要学习技术的业务员,应该掌握哪些MySQL基础命令?
MySQL数据库常用基础命令 对于想要学习技术的业务员来说,理解MySQL的基础命令至关重要。这些命令使你能够轻松执行关键的任务,例如创建、修改和管理数据库及其内容。 MySQL功能型语句 以下是一...
sql是什么意思
sql全称是结构化查询语言,即Structured Query Language,是一种特殊目的的编程语言,是一种数据库查询和程序设计语言,用于存取数据以及查询、更新和管理关系数据库系统,同时也是数据库脚本文...
Laravel开发经验总结:如何处理文件上传与下载
在Laravel开发中,处理文件上传与下载是一个常见的需求。无论是用户上传头像、图片,还是下载用户生成的报告,文件操作都是开发者必须面对的问题。本文将总结一些在Laravel中处理文件上传与下载...
mysql如何实现读写分离?有哪些中间件?
mysql实现读写分离的核心逻辑是将写操作(insert、update、delete)发到主库,读操作(select)分散到从库。其原理基于主从复制机制,主库处理写请求并将数据变更同步至从库,应用层或中间件负...